Re: New England Prep 2009-2010

Here are the top 8 in Division 1 according to their published records ONLY against Division 1 teams.


Choate ................. 8-0-1
Williston-Northampton... 6-1-0
Brewster Academy........ 8-1-1
Westminster............. 6-1-1
Noble & Greenough....... 7-1-3
Lawrence................ 5-1-2
Berkshire............... 8-4-0
Tabor................... 7-4-1


Tomorrow's Lawrence-Nobles game should be a dandy. Lawrence is definitely a serious contender. Berkshire and Tabor both have a good chance to be in the field of 8 a few short weeks from now.

Great game tonight as Nobles edges Lawrence, 1-0.

First period was pretty balanced, with perhaps a slight edge to Lawrence in shots and time of offensive zone possession, but that would change for the latter two periods.

I was very impressed with the Field/Simpson combo for Lawrence. Great players....clearly great athletes in general. The only thing stopping these two quality forwards was the elite squad of blue liners that Nobles boasts, not to mention a very clean performance by Ms. Blake.
